St. Joseph Calasanz visiting Rome in 1648 could not stay indifferent to the negative human and social consequences of ignorance. In the midst of the social crisis, God called him to found a religious order dedicated to social transformation through education. That is how the Order of the Pious Schools (Piarist or Calasanzian Fathers) was founded.
In the Central African region, the Piarist Fathers, following the example of their founder are responding to severe human and social crisis at all levels. In the English-speaking part of Cameroon in particular, a civil war has been going on for four years. About 3,500 lives have been lost, 550 villages burned down, 3000 imprisoned and the worst of it is that about 1 million children have not been to school for four long years. The negative consequences of this war are enormous: malnutrition and hunger, fear and trauma, violence begetting more violence, separated and displaced families with many orphans and widows.
The only thing that is keeping the people alive is their faith. Despite all odds, the church remains the only institution that is present to give hope to the people.
